在Android设备上使用GitHub上的Shadowsocks

目录

什么是Shadowsocks

Shadowsocks 是一个开源的代理工具,主要用于科学上网。它的原理是通过创建一个安全的、加密的通道来帮助用户访问被限制的网站。使用Shadowsocks,用户可以隐蔽自己的上网行为,提高网络安全性。

为什么选择Shadowsocks

选择Shadowsocks 的理由有很多,包括但不限于:

  • 速度快:Shadowsocks使用加密技术,能够在保护隐私的同时确保连接的速度。
  • 使用简单:与传统VPN相比,Shadowsocks的设置过程更为简单,尤其适合新手用户。
  • 可定制性:用户可以根据个人需求进行高级设置。
  • 开源项目:作为开源软件,用户可以查看代码和修改软件,提高透明度和安全性。

如何在Android上安装Shadowsocks

1. 下载Shadowsocks应用

在Google Play Store或GitHub上下载Shadowsocks应用程序。

2. 安装应用

在下载完成后,点击安装并遵循安装步骤。如果你的设备开启了未知来源的安装,可能需要在设置中允许此项操作。

3. 允许必要的权限

安装完成后,打开Shadowsocks应用,系统可能会提示你授予某些权限,如VPN权限。

4. 设置代理

打开应用后,你需要输入代理服务器的相关信息,这些信息通常包括:

  • 服务器地址:你要连接的代理服务器的IP地址。
  • 端口:代理服务器使用的端口号。
  • 密码:访问代理的密码。
  • 加密方式:选择一种加密协议,比如AES-256-GCM。

5. 连接代理

完成设置后,点击连接按钮,应用会自动建立与代理服务器的连接。连接成功后,你就可以开始使用科学上网了。

Shadowsocks的基本配置

配置文件管理

Shadowsocks 提供了一种方便的方式来管理配置文件,你可以导入或导出配置文件,方便其他设备使用。通常配置文件为JSON格式,里面包含了服务器信息等。

选择代理模式

在应用中可以选择不同的代理模式,例如:

  • 全局代理:所有的网络流量都通过代理。
  • 分应用代理:仅特定应用通过代理。
  • 绕过局域网:局域网流量不走代理。

使用Shadowsocks的注意事项

使用Shadowsocks 需要注意以下几点:

  • 定期更新:保持应用和代理服务器的更新,以获得更好的性能和安全性。
  • 注意网络安全:使用公共Wi-Fi时,请确保安全性,避免数据泄露。
  • 遵循当地法律法规:使用代理工具时,请务必遵循所在国家的法律法规。

常见问题解答

Q1: Shadowsocks和VPN有什么区别?

Shadowsocks 是一种代理工具,而VPN是虚拟专用网络,两者的工作原理和使用目的略有不同。Shadowsocks通常速度更快,而VPN提供更全面的加密和隐私保护。

Q2: 如何更改Shadowsocks的服务器?

在应用内,打开设置,找到服务器设置,可以输入新的服务器地址和端口,完成后保存即可更改服务器。

Q3: 如果连接不成功怎么办?

如果Shadowsocks 无法连接,可能需要检查以下内容:

  • 服务器地址和端口是否输入正确。
  • 网络连接是否正常。
  • 服务器是否在线。

Q4: 是否可以在没有根权限的情况下使用Shadowsocks?

是的,Shadowsocks 不需要设备获得根权限即可使用,用户可以直接在未越狱的设备上正常使用。

Q5: Shadowsocks的安全性如何?

由于Shadowsocks 使用加密通道来传输数据,因此相对来说安全性较高。但建议用户在使用时仍需保持警惕,避免输入敏感信息。

通过本文的详细介绍,相信你已经掌握了如何在Android设备上使用GitHub上的Shadowsocks。如果在使用过程中有任何问题,可以随时查阅本篇文章,或者参考社区的相关讨论。希望大家能够顺利实现科学上网,畅游网络世界。

正文完